BREAKING: Labour Rejects Proposal As FG Raises Minimum Wage To N54,000

May 21, (THEWILL) – The Nigeria Labour Congress (NLC) and Trade Union Congress (TUC) have again rejected the N54,000 proposed by the Federal Government as the new minimum wage.

This followed the resumption of negotiations by the Tripartite Committee on New National Minimum Wage after the NLC and TUC rejected the N48,000 minimum wage earlier proposed by the Federal Government.

According to Vanguard, one of the leaders of organised labour who attended the meeting on Tuesday said the new offer of N54,000 has also been rejected.

The unions had insisted on N615,000 as the new minimum wage for workers.
